Characters in 'Dragon Ball Z' and its remastered counterpart 'Dragon Ball Z Kai' undergo some of the most remarkable changes throughout their arcs. In 'DBZ', we witness Goku's transformation from a naive kid who loved fighting and food into a responsible father and a powerful warrior. His willingness to train and face increasingly formidable foes, such as Frieza and Cell, highlights his growth. Yet, what's fascinating is that while Goku matures, his childlike joy and innocence remain, creating this perfect balance of character depth.

Vegeta’s evolution is arguably one of the most compelling in the series. Initially introduced as a ruthless villain, his progression into a hero is marked by personal struggles and conflicts, both external and internal. As he travels from the cold-hearted Saiyan prince to a committed protector of Earth, his rivalry with Goku shifts from mere hatred to respect, showcasing true development. This dynamic adds layers to both characters, and their interactions really pull viewers into their transformation.

Moreover, characters like Piccolo have deep transformations that go beyond mere fighting prowess. Early on, he is Goku’s enemy, but through his relationship with Goku and later Gohan, we see him evolve into a mentor and protector. His character arc reflects themes of redemption and friendship. Each character's development becomes a tapestry woven from their challenges, triumphs, and relationships, making the show deeper than just epic battles. It's about growth in various forms, and that’s what keeps fans coming back. I adore how these arcs continue to resonate with audiences, rejuvenating the show with each new generation.

How Does DBZ Kakarot Novel Differ From The Game?

3 Answers2026-02-06 23:18:51
The 'DBZ Kakarot' game and its novel adaptation are two very different beasts, though they share the same core story. The game is an action RPG that lets you relive Goku's journey from the Saiyan Saga to the Buu Saga, complete with side quests, open-world exploration, and flashy combat. It's immersive in a way that lets you punch, fly, and eat your way through the Dragon Ball universe. The novel, on the other hand, is a straight retelling of the game's narrative—no button mashing required. It dives deeper into character thoughts and emotions, something the game can only hint at during cutscenes. What's fascinating is how the novel fills in gaps the game glosses over. For instance, the novel gives more insight into Goku's internal struggles during key moments, like his fight with Vegeta or the emotional weight of Cell's defeat. The game’s strength is its interactivity—you feel the Kamehameha charging in your hands—but the novel’s prose lets you linger in those quiet, introspective moments the game rushes through. If you’re a lore junkie, the novel’s extra details are a treat, but if you crave adrenaline, the game’s the obvious pick.

Why Is DBZ Mystic Gohan Considered The Strongest Form?

3 Answers2026-02-10 05:06:11
Mystic Gohan’s strength in 'Dragon Ball Z' has always fascinated me because it represents a rare moment where raw potential eclipses brute-force transformations. Unlike the Super Saiyan route, which relies on emotional triggers and energy multipliers, Gohan’s 'Ultimate' form (as it’s officially called) is a full unlock of his latent power by the Elder Kai. It’s not just about flashy hair or auras—it’s the culmination of his hybrid Saiyan-human genetics and years of untapped ability. The form feels like a reward for his growth, from the scared kid in 'DBZ' to the warrior who stood toe-to-toe with Buu. What makes it feel 'strongest' is the narrative weight. Gohan was always hinted to have unparalleled potential, even as a child. The Mystic form sidesteps the Saiyan tradition of escalating transformations (no SSJ3 drawbacks here) and instead offers a refined, efficient version of his power. It’s a shame we didn’t see more of it—post-Buu arc, the series shifted focus, but for that arc, Gohan’s calm confidence and sheer dominance against Super Buu solidified the form’s legendary status.
